What Makes Next.js Different

Server-Side Rendering = Better SEO

Google needs to see your content to rank it. With old React apps, Google sees a blank page and waits for JavaScript to load. With Next.js, Google gets the fully rendered HTML immediately — exactly what search engines want.

Result: Pages that rank faster and rank higher.

App Router = Faster Pages

Next.js 15's App Router uses React Server Components, which means only the interactive parts of your page are sent as JavaScript. Static content comes as plain HTML — lightning fast.

Typical performance scores: 95+ on Google PageSpeed Insights vs. 60-70 for most WordPress sites.

Built-In Image Optimisation

Next.js automatically converts images to WebP, serves the right size for each screen, and lazy-loads below-the-fold images. You upload a PNG, users get a perfectly optimised WebP.

Edge Deployment

Deploy globally on Vercel's edge network — your site loads from a server physically close to each visitor. An Indian user gets fast response from Mumbai; a US user from Virginia.
